Dr Kelly Neaves Mcdonough, MD - Medicare Diagnostic Radiology in Edmond, OK

Dr Kelly Neaves Mcdonough, MD is a medicare enrolled "Radiology - Diagnostic Radiology" physician in Edmond, Oklahoma. She went to University Of Oklahoma College Of Medicine and graduated in 1994 and has 30 years of diverse experience with area of expertise as Diagnostic Radiology. She is a member of the group practice Ou Health Partners Inc and her current practice location is 2601 Kelley Pointe Pkwy, Ste 101, Edmond, Oklahoma. You can reach out to her office (for appointments etc.) via phone at (405) 844-2601.

Dr Kelly Neaves Mcdonough is licensed to practice in Oklahoma (license number 19508) and she also participates in the medicare program. She accepts medicare assignments (which means she accepts the Medicare-approved amount; you will not be billed for any more than the Medicare deductible and coinsurance) and her NPI Number is 1831195528.

Medicare Reassignments

Some practitioners may not bill the customers directly but medicare billing happens through clinics / group practice / hospitals where the provider works. Medicare reassignment of benefits is a mechanism by which practitioners allow third parties to bill and receive payment for medicare services performed by them. Medicare Part D Prescriber Enrollment

Any physician or other eligible professional who prescribes Part D drugs must either enroll in the Medicare program or opt out in order to prescribe drugs to their patients with Part D prescription drug benefit plans. Dr Kelly Neaves Mcdonough is enrolled with medicare and thus, if eligible, can prescribe medicare part D drugs to patients with medicare part D benefits.
